The beachlands is ideal for a family fun day out by the seaside. The beaches at Hayling Island for example are recommended by the Good Beach Guide meaning its a perfect spot for a paddle or a swim.
The New Forest is another attraction sure to be a hit with the whole family, it was made a National Park in 2005 and you will find deer, ponies and cows roaming the heaths and woodlands. Enjoy a stroll around or hire a bike (or horse!) and take in the scenery. You will be able to stop off at one of the local family friendly pubs for a spot of lunch and well-earned rest!
